Whatever the technique of cultivation hygiene is always important. In hydroponic systems special attention should be paid to the nutrient solution, which must be replaced regularly to avoid accumulation of salts, dirt and pathogens. Normally the discharge should be done about every two weeks, three if you work with reverse osmosis water, one in the case of brackish water. The intense heat may necessitate more frequent replacement parts. The emptying of the system can be difficult, usually taking place under these schemes:
-The tube that leads from the pump to the irrigation system is equipped with a valve in line with the possibility to divert the flow toward a third exhaust pipe.
-The tank has a slope on the bottom to the end of which is present an exhaust valve. Opening the valve the water flows thanks to the force of gravity.
-Use of a "bilge pump", practical and light you can immerse at the time of need in the tank by connecting it to a tube arranged for unloading. Unfortunately this type of pumps always leave a stagnation of about one centimeter on the bottom, but can be used in association with the previous method.
In recirculating systems the pH value should be noted on a daily basis, since the variations in the nutrient solution made from the plants themselves may cause fluctuations important. In any case, it is essential the measurement every time they are added water or the fertilizers.
To maintain the acidity stable you can resort to the use of nutrients that offer a " cushioning effect "or buffer , and to a regulation of the temperature (less than 30 degrees) and humidity (greater than 50%) such as to reduce the 'excessive evaporation.
To make the measurement will proceed as for the EC, to mix the solution thoroughly and take a sample with a clean container. It 's good not to take measurements immediately after the addition of fertilizers or regulators.
The plants subtract from the nutrient solution fertilizers and water simultaneously, but not necessarily to the same extent.
In a hot climate such as the plants tend to "drink" more, and together with the high evaporation rate makes this the concentration of nutrients is too high. To maintain stable and under control of the equilibrium solution is necessary to monitor the EC or electrical conductivity.
This value is the only way we can determine exactly how many nutrients are still present in the water. A presence too high will damage the plants, while too little will track deficiencies and development slowed. To detect the EC using a special instrument that indicates the amount of salts (total, so no distinctions) dissolved. There are several models of portable or fixed gauges with probes of different price ranges.

The sorrow of the lovers for years hydroponics has been that of not being able to combine the performance and speed of their culture with a biological approach. The specific fertilizers for hydroponics in fact are by definition minerals, or chemicals. The nourishment organic typical of organic farming tends in fact to clog pipes and sprayers, because of the rather large particles in suspension in the solution. These particles may stagnate toward the bottom and rot, creating foul odors and the risk of contamination by pathogens.

It seems strange, but also in the desert is virtually possible to adequately feed sheep, horses or cows with relatively cool herbs rich in minerals. The solution is a room of cultivation seeds automated, ie a technology of production of plant biomass in a controlled environment, obtained from the germination and the rapid growth of the plants, with the result of forage high digestibility, nutritional quality high and very suitable for 's animal feed. The supply of fresh herbs beneficial to livestock health, making it stronger, healthy, fertile and productive.
What is it in practice? We speak of a special chamber of hydroponic cultivation, a sort of super growroom, inside of which are grown in trays oats, barley, corn, wheat, sorghum, alfalfa.

Thanet Earth is a project of gigantic dimensions started in the United Kingdom. The most monumental and technologically advanced greenhouse devoted to growing hydroponic ever conceived on the island of Thanet, in Kent, and uses a glass surface of 80 football fields.
The goal is to grow lettuce using advanced technology to create a hydroponic production system fully eco-compatible. The declared cost of Thanet Earth is 80 million pounds, only to give effect to the structure, which belongs to the 50% to the company a leader in the field of vegetable production Makers. The remaining 50% belongs to other known brands specializing in the cultivation of vegetables and salads: Kaaij Redstar, Rainbow Growers and A & A. The roses The roses are among the plants grown in the most absolute in the world, grow easily, but needs some attention. First the water must be very abundant, the temperature is not excessive and the direct sunlight for six hours every day. In the case of indoor cultivation lighting the formula recommended by lush flowering is the alternation of 12 hours of light to darkness with 12, and recommended an additional carbon dioxide. To manage these factors is essential to implement a timer to automate operations. Roses are subject to infestations: indoor cultivation and hydroponics eliminates several sources of trouble, whereas the earth is the ideal environment for proliferation of most of the creatures we would like to avoid having in our rose garden.
